Holding a router is not usually a problem, holding the material still
can be.

A router table is a nice thing to have, but with a good saw you can
build a router table!

I suggest you buy a saw table like this and a cheap router, you will
probably be able to attach the router with no need of any expensive
extras, most router bases have a selection of holes to mount them
with, a few screws may be needed to suit the holes. You will have to
modify the fence on the saw table by adding a bit of wood with a gap
in the middle so that the router bit will stick up and have a guide
either side.
